Output c170a295a3cff27977a55ca076973f81a2b1a18f6653e58135075cbc22470537:3

value
24412000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 735bd58e35560a01c040fb0a5d3ee106bd773afb OP_EQUAL
address
3CCyeMdDuYSYEv8zfr5JYhQYGXYAX5LqJp
transaction
c170a295a3cff27977a55ca076973f81a2b1a18f6653e58135075cbc22470537
confirmations
359671
spent
true